> Jérôme Charron wrote: > > I really don't like this solution to centralize this kind of > informations. > > I think, it's the plugin responsability to claim the > > content-type/path-suffix it can handle. > > However, what happens if more than one plugin claims that it can handle > any given content-type? E.g. html parser may claim that it supports > plaintext. but there is another plugin specifically for plaintext. Which > of them wins?
That's the drawback of this solution (randomly choose a plugin if many claims to handle a content-type) The drawback of the "centralized" one is to give to the administrator the ability to easily associate parse-plugin to a content-type this one doesn't handle.
